Ingredient Benefits

  • Bacillus coagulans: A hardy, spore‑forming probiotic that supports digestion and gut immunity. It can help reduce gas and diarrhoea.
  • Bacillus indicus: Produces carotenoids and other beneficial compounds that support antioxidant defences and gut health.
  • Saccharomyces boulardii: A beneficial yeast shown to help maintain gut flora balance and support immune function.
  • Apple extract & Pumpkin seed extract: Provide dietary fibre and polyphenols that aid digestion.
  • Bromelain: A digestive enzyme from pineapple that helps break down proteins.
